Board logo

标题: [文本处理] 批处理如何解除U盘免疫? [打印本页]

作者: a4025    时间: 2009-4-22 16:56     标题: 批处理如何解除U盘免疫?

下面是我在网上找的批处理    U盘防火墙+杀毒软件   可能是我不会用吧!安装了后就不会解除了!连格式化都有问题!
我还是把代码贴出来吧!
@echo off
title U盘安全摸板让你的U盘永里的数据永远不会被病毒感染      
mode con: cols=85 lines=25
cls
color 9f
set tm1=%time:~0,2%
set tm2=%time:~3,2%
set tm3=%time:~6,2%
cls
echo                      系统版本号: v1.0.3            
echo.        
echo.                 
ECHO                   系统当前时间:%date% %tm1%点%tm2%分%tm3%秒
echo.  ╔═══════════════════════════════════════╗
echo   ║                                声明                                          ║
echo.  ║         本程序为U盘打造一个安全的储存和自动化的安装环境.                     ║
echo.  ║                                                                              ║
echo.  ║         我会定时对次版本更新,使其更加完善。                                  ║
echo.  ║                                                                              ║
echo.  ║         有什么不足的地方请大家提出来。                                       ║
echo.  ║                                                                              ║
echo.  ║                              ║
echo.  ║                                                                              ║
echo.  ║         我们还很年轻,离不开你们的支持!                                     ║
echo.  ║                                                                              ║
echo   ║                                                                              ║
echo   ╚═══════════════════════════════════════╝
pause
title U盘安全摸板让你的U盘永里的数据永远不会被病毒感染      QQ:63420978
@rem  本程序会转换U盘格式为NTFS
for %%i in (C D E F G H I J K L M N O P Q R S T U V W X Y Z) do fsutil fsinfo drivetype %%i: >>drv.txt
find "移动" drv.txt >drive.txt
for /f "skip=2  tokens=1 delims=:" %%q in (drive.txt) do (echo y|convert %%q: /fs:ntfs
md %%q:\ADD&md %%q:\CON\&echo 纪录一些重要的事件>%%q:\Event.txt
echo [.ShellClassInfo]                                                      >%%q:\ADD\desktop.ini
echo IconFile=^%%SystemRoot^%%\system32\SHELL32.dll                        >>%%q:\ADD\desktop.ini
echo IconIndex=8                                                           >>%%q:\ADD\desktop.ini
echo Infotip=                                                              >>%%q:\ADD\desktop.ini
echo ConfirmFileOp=0                                                       >>%%q:\ADD\desktop.ini
echo set ws=wscript.createobject^(^"wscript.shell^"^)                            >%%q:\Auto.vbs
echo ws.run ^"Auto.cmd /start^",0                                                >>%%q:\Auto.vbs
echo @echo off                                                                       >%%q:\AutoMation.cmd
echo mode con cols=55 lines=7                                                       >>%%q:\AutoMation.cmd
echo  echo                  一件复制所需内容                                        >>%%q:\AutoMation.cmd
echo  echo     1:system  2:softwre  3:game  4:backup                                >>%%q:\AutoMation.cmd
echo  echo                                        全部复制到桌面                    >>%%q:\AutoMation.cmd
echo set /p auto=       请选择  :        >>%%q:\AutoMation.cmd
echo if ^"^%%auto^%%^"==^"1^"   goto 1                                              >>%%q:\AutoMation.cmd
echo if ^"^%%auto^%%^"==^"2^"   goto 2                                              >>%%q:\AutoMation.cmd
echo if ^"^%%auto^%%^"==^"3^"   goto 3                                              >>%%q:\AutoMation.cmd
echo if ^"^%%auto^%%^"==^"4^"   goto 4                                              >>%%q:\AutoMation.cmd
echo :1                                                                             >>%%q:\AutoMation.cmd
echo for ^%%%%i in ^(C D E F G H I J K L M N O P Q R S T U V W X Y Z^) do fsutil fsinfo drivetype ^%%%%i:^| find ^"移动^"  ^&^& copy ^%%%%i:\sec..\system  ^"%%userprofile^%%\桌面^"        >>%%q:\AutoMation.cmd
echo exit                                                                           >>%%q:\AutoMation.cmd
echo :2                                                                             >>%%q:\AutoMation.cmd
echo for ^%%%%i in ^(C D E F G H I J K L M N O P Q R S T U V W X Y Z^) do fsutil fsinfo drivetype ^%%%%i:^| find ^"移动^"  ^&^& copy ^%%%%i:\sec..\software     ^"%%userprofile^%%\桌面^"   >>%%q:\AutoMation.cmd
echo exit                                                                           >>%%q:\AutoMation.cmd  
echo :3                                                                              >>%%q:\AutoMation.cmd
echo for ^%%%%i in ^(C D E F G H I J K L M N O P Q R S T U V W X Y Z^) do fsutil fsinfo drivetype ^%%%%i:^| find ^"移动^"  ^&^& copy ^%%%%i:\sec..\game  ^"%%userprofile^%%\桌面^"          >>%%q:\AutoMation.cmd
echo exit                                                                            >>%%q:\AutoMation.cmd
echo :4                                                                              >>%%q:\AutoMation.cmd
echo md ^"%userprofile%\桌面\BackUp^"                      >>%%q:\AutoMation.cmd
echo for ^%%%%i in ^(C D E F G H I J K L M N O P Q R S T U V W X Y Z^) do fsutil fsinfo drivetype ^%%%%i:^| find ^"移动^"  ^&^& copy ^%%%%i:\sec..\backup ^"%%userprofile^%%\桌面\backup^"  >>%%q:\AutoMation.cmd
echo exit                                                                            >>%%q:\AutoMation.cmd
                                                    del /f /s drv.txt & DEL /F /S DRIVE.TXT                     
echo @echo off >%%q:\Auto.cmd
echo for ^%%%%i in ^(C D E F G H I J K L M N O P Q R S T U V W X Y Z^) do fsutil fsinfo drivetype ^%%%%^i:^| find ^"移动^"  ^&^& start ^%%%%i:\sec..\ ^&^&taskkill /f /im cmd.exe >>%%q:\Auto.cmd
echo exit     >>%%q:\Auto.cmd
echo ^[AutoRun^]      >%%q:\AutoRun.inf
echo icon=o.ico      >>%%q:\AUtoRun.inf
                                                                 md %%q:\sec..\
                                                                 md %%q:\sec
                                                                 md %%q:\sec\defend..\
                                                                 md %%q:\sec..\System
                                                                 md %%q:\sec..\Software
                                                                 md %%q:\sec..\Game
                                                                 md %%q:\sec..\BackUp
                                                                 attrib +a +r +s +h %%q:\sec
                                                                 attrib +h %%q:\autorun.inf
                                                                 attrib +h %%q:\auto.cmd
                                                                 attrib +h %%q:\add\desktop.ini
                                                                 echo Y|cacls %%q:\sec /p everyone:r
                                                                 echo Y|cacls %%q: /p everyone:r
                                                                 echo y|cacls %%q:\autorun.inf /p everyone:r
                                                                 echo y|cacls %%q:\automation.cmd /p everyone:r
                                                                 echo y|cacls %%q:\auto.vbs /p everyone:r      
                                                                 echo y|cacls %%q:\auto.cmd /p everyone:r
                                                                      )
作者: a4025    时间: 2009-4-22 16:56

或者哪位教下我怎么用这个P处理
作者: qwe13518    时间: 2009-7-22 23:03

这是我写的批处理,要解除加我的QQ372396883




欢迎光临 批处理之家 (http://bbs.bathome.net/) Powered by Discuz! 7.2